Added: Bootstrap error and report issue (optionally) will contain primary termux files stat info and logcat dump

Users have been reporting issues with bootstrap installation (and `login` file access) failure on email and github but "most" have been useless since they don't follow instructions to debug the issue and report back. The real reason may depend on device. One could be that `/data/data/com.termux` does not exist on the device in which case termux won't work on the device, at least without root. Other reasons could be wrong ownership or selinux context, selinux denials or attempting to install on external sd card (as reported by a user) where likely files dir was different from `/data/data/com.termux/files`.

This commit will save dev and possibly user time and automatically generate the required info to debug such issues. The `ls` command will generate `stat` info for all the major termux directories and files so that existence or ownership issues can be shown. It will also run `logcat` command to take a dump (last `3000` lines) in case other failures are being logged, like selinux denials as per `avc` entries. It will also show if app is installed on external sd card. This info will automatically be shown on bootstrap install failure report.

Moreover, users can generate termux files `stat` info and `logcat` dump manually too with terminal's long hold options menu `More` -> `Report Issue` option and selecting `YES` in the prompt shown to add debug info. This can be helpful for reporting and debugging other issues. If the report generated is too large, then `Save To File` option in context menu (3 dots on top right) of `ReportActivity` can be used and the file viewed/shared instead.

Users must post complete report (optionally without sensitive info) when reporting issues, instead of (partial) screenshots which won't be accepted anymore.

There has been some design changes in android 11 for `/data/data` and `/data/user/0` directory. You can check javadoc for `isTermuxFilesDirectoryAccessible()` function in [`TermuxFileUtils`](termux-shared/src/main/java/com/termux/shared/file/TermuxFileUtils.java) for details.
